Automated Essay Scoring: Exploring the Utility and Potential of the Large Language Models for the WrightRightNow Platform. Technical Report #2301
Cengiz Zopluoglu; Gerald Tindal
Behavioral Research and Teaching
WriteRightNow (https://writerightnow.com) is an innovative digital platform meticulously crafted to enhance writing instruction across various curricula. Central to its design is the customization of instructional content, allowing for a multi-faceted approach that caters to diverse student needs, including those with special educational requirements and English learners. This technical report presents the methodology and findings of research focused on the development of an essay scoring algorithm for the WriteRightNow (WRN) platform. The purpose is to explore the feasibility and utility of automating the essay grading process, thereby enhancing efficiency and reducing the workload of educators. Through rigorous analysis, the report seeks to offer insights into the potential benefits and practical implementation of this technological advancement within WRN, emphasizing its capacity to streamline educational processes and improve the overall teaching and learning experience.
